The European production value of event catering is led by Germany, accounting for 24.73 million Euros, followed by the United Kingdom and France. Notably, Spain and Poland showcased significant year-on-year growth at 22.61% and 12.53% respectively. Conversely, the UK experienced a decline of 3.07%. Countries like Luxembourg, Serbia, and Macedonia displayed notable upward trends, indicating emerging market potential. Over the last five years, the compounded annual growth rate for most regions indicates gradual improvement aside from slight setbacks in some countries.

Top countries in Production Value of Event Catering Share by Country (Million Euros)
| # | 10 Countries | Percent | Last Year | YoY | 5-years CAGR | |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1 | 1 Germany | 24.73 | 2023 | +18.18% | +5.88% | View data |
| 2 | 2 United Kingdom | 21.45 | 2023 | -3.28% | -3.07% | View data |
| 3 | 3 France | 12.24 | 2023 | +12% | -0.37% | View data |
| 4 | 4 Spain | 8.63 | 2023 | +9.49% | +22.61% | View data |
| 5 | 5 Belgium | 6.55 | 2023 | +10.4% | +1.03% | View data |
| 6 | 6 Italy | 5.88 | 2023 | +17.11% | +3.37% | View data |
| 7 | 7 Poland | 5.15 | 2023 | +19.35% | +12.53% | View data |
| 8 | 8 Denmark | 2.27 | 2023 | +6.89% | +2.74% | View data |
| 9 | 9 Norway | 2.23 | 2023 | +6.2% | +0.8% | View data |
| 10 | 10 Ireland | 2.21 | 2023 | +12.3% | +7.43% | View data |
